Simple Circumference Calculator: Formula and Examples
Calculating the distance around of a circle, known as its circumference, is fairly straightforward using a simple formula . The basic formula is C = 2πr, where ‘C’ stands for the circumference, π (pi) is a mathematical value approximately equal to 3.14159, and ‘r’ denotes the radius of the circle. For illustration, if a circle has a radius of 5 units , then its circumference would be 2 * 3.14159 * 5 = approximately 31.4159 centimeters . Alternatively, if you know the diameter (d), which is twice the radius, you can use click here the formula C = πd. So, if the diameter is 10 units , the circumference becomes 3.14159 * 10 = approximately 31.4159 inches. This approach provides a quick and simple way to determine the circumference of any circle.
